Output 85e0aea71f4acffe3299e6fed0e8822e9224d547ec09175c5371aa9e22e5dfc3:0

value
3405770781
script pubkey
OP_0 OP_PUSHBYTES_20 075eb0c0f056e56a5be963aadd64795fc658ce31
address
tb1qqa0tps8s2mjk5klfvw4d6eretlr93n33wd23wu
transaction
85e0aea71f4acffe3299e6fed0e8822e9224d547ec09175c5371aa9e22e5dfc3